DHF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

46 of the 4,605 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in BNY Mellon High Yield Strategies Fund (DHF)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$14.8M — down 7.5% from $16M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 12 funds closed out of DHF and 9 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 9 trimmed existing stakes and 15 added.

The largest buyer was Shaker Financial Services, adding an estimated $807K.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$2.37M.
